Public bug reported:

Can connect to an open wireless network fine in Gutsy, but if I try to
connect to an encrypted network the whole system crashes. The computer
must be hard-reset. The machine is a gateway ml3109, with wireless
chipset Realtek RTL 8185L. It's nice that it's at least pseudo-supported
under gutsy, in feisty it didn't work at all without ndiswrapper!
